Recipe: How to Make Homemade Egg Pasta for Cristy

Fresh egg noodles are great with a rich alfredo sauce. This recipe makes enough pasta for four people.
1 tbsp. olive (not virgin) oil
1 tsp. salt
3 eggs
2 1/2 c. all-purpose flour
measuring spoons
measuring cups
Sift the flour into a mound on a countertop or board, or, if it's more comfortable for you, into a large bowl.
Make a well in the center of the flour.
Add eggs, salt, and olive oil to the well.
Mix liquid and flour together with fingers.
Knead pasta dough until it is elastic. Let stand for one hour.
Flour table and rolling pin, and roll out dough to a very thin sheet, flouring surface liberally.
Roll the sheet up into a roll, like a jelly roll.
Cut 1/4-inch to 1/2-inch slices from the roll.
Unroll the strips and hang to dry. Hang on clean broom handle or over a towel on stair rails.
Dry pasta for at least 10 to 15 minutes before using. For best results, dry for two hours.
Tips:
You can use a pasta machine to make the noodles more uniform in shape and simplify the rolling and cutting.
